Detailed Solution
Download Solution PDFसंकल्पना:
P(R ∪ S) = P(R) + P(S) - P(R
यदि R और S पारस्परिक रूप से असंयुक्त हैं, तो P(R
गणना:
माना कि R और S पारस्परिक रूप से असंयुक्त हैं, तो
P(R ∪ S) = P(R) + P(S) - P(R
0.6 = 0.4 + p - 0
p = 0.2
